Abstract: The invention relates to a vertical scaffolding element consisting of a tubular portion provided with a number n of radially projecting sockets, distributed peripherally in a star arrangement, designed for the attachment of one end of a horizontal crosspiece of the scaffolding; the sockets are defined by a metal strip folded in order to form a star-shaped part closed on itself having protuberances forming the said sockets alternating with re-entrant regions bearing against the tubular portion, the upper and lower edges of the re-entrant regions in contact with the tubular portion being welded thereto by continuous or discontinuous annular weld beads.
Abstract: A scaffolding system for volumes of various shapes that present a bottom and end walls. The system includes at least a first scaffolding structure having a gantry with at least two interconnected vertical poles; guides secured to the bottom of the volume to guide the poles in rectilinear displacement in a longitudinal direction; a horizontal main platform defining at least a working floor, and guides for guiding the main platform in vertical translation along the poles; at least two horizontal auxiliary platforms each defining a working floor mounted to move in horizontal translation relative to the main platform; and structure for displacing each auxiliary platform separately relative to the main platform between a retracted position and an extended position in which the outer edge of the auxiliary platform is substantially in register with the outer edge of the main platform.
